Inclusions and Pricing
Included in the Extreme Humantay Lake Day Trip is transportation via private vehicle, with hotel pickup and drop-off.
Travelers will enjoy a buffet lunch and the services of a driver/guide throughout the day. The tour also includes coffee/tea and all necessary fees and taxes.
Horses are available for rent at an additional cost of S/.80 per person, if needed.
The tour is priced from $40.00 per person, with a lowest price guarantee. However, the tour has a non-refundable policy, so there are no refunds for cancellations.
Meeting and Pickup
The Extreme Humantay Lake Day Trip tour begins at Plaza Regocijo in Cusco, just one block from the iconic Plaza de Armas.
Pickup options are available for hotels outside Cusco, and the tour concludes back at the meeting point.
The tour operates daily from 4:00 AM to 5:00 PM, with the trip running from May 4, 2021, to November 20, 2025.

Requirements and Recommendations
The Extreme Humantay Lake Day Trip isn’t wheelchair accessible.
Travelers should come prepared with recommended items like water, rain ponchos, local currency, fruits, cameras, warm clothing, sunglasses, sunscreen, and comfortable walking shoes.
This tour isn’t suitable for those with back problems, heart conditions, or other serious medical issues. A moderate level of physical fitness is required, as the tour involves hiking up to 4,200 meters.

What Is the Weather Typically Like During the Tour?
The weather during this tour is generally cool and sunny, with temperatures ranging from around 5-15°C (41-59°F). However, it can change quickly in the mountains, so layered clothing and rain protection are recommended.
